So today and it’s a flippers job at Newbury and Doncaster for a Saturday that has a distinctly pre Festival feel to it. The best race is up north where it really is Grim today and the errr Grimthorpe Chase at 3.35. Known as a Grand National Trial we can rest assured they will all try as the weights for the National are out already. This was won easily by the Last Samurai last year but I hear he is less forward now then then and it’s all about Aintree.

That leaves the way clear for Ya Elenki from Ventia Williams yard that revel in the mud. On similar ground he dotted up at Haydock and the tactics will be similar today, take it up and see who can keep going. I have a feeling not many will finish this course and Ya Elenki will do for me at 7/2 with Bet Victor.
